Transaction 308c76a3c4bd5d974a0c9b7c19033766144f82757776a6c49ff19eb30384e97d

1 Input
2 Outputs
  • 308c76a3c4bd5d974a0c9b7c19033766144f82757776a6c49ff19eb30384e97d:0
  • value  3000000
    address  13ByfgBUhwHQT2q6J4QkCMY8a3W6xmtHMk
  • 308c76a3c4bd5d974a0c9b7c19033766144f82757776a6c49ff19eb30384e97d:1
  • value  13925224
    address  17qqhoswZrXdyL1U8CiZhg4AQEfv6VLgfE